How does the dart impact tester work?
- You can start by operating this machine by plugging it into the main socket of the machine in 3 pins 15 amp socket.
- Once you start the machine, then you can easily place the specimen accurately. It is important for you to make sure that the specimen will be placed accurately on this testing machine so that one can get accurate testing results.
- When you place the specimen accurately, then you need to set the height of the dart. You need to adjust the height of the release mechanism according to the test requirement.
- For testing fix the electro-magnet rod at different lengths of 660 mm & 1524 mm with the formula below:
- -Required length + Dart length + electro magnet length= Scale Reading
- Once you set the height of the testing specimen, then you can easily commence the test.

Technical Specifications of Presto dart impact tester manual model
- Inside diameter of clamp: 127mm
- Diameter of dart head: Method A – 38 mm, Method B 50.8 mm ± 0.13 mm
- Height of fall:660 mm and 1524 mm(Adjustable)
- Maximum weight holding capacity of Dart Holding Mechanism: 2Kg
- Dart Head Material: Method A Phenolic & Method B - Steel
- Least Count of Height Adjustable Clamp: 1 mm
- Type of test: FreeFalling Dart
- Release Mechanism: Electromagnetic dart hold/release mechanism
- Clamping Unit: Circular annular clamping unit with zero slippage
- Counter: Digital.
- A vacuum Pump of CFM 1.8, 1/4 Hp Motor is provided with it.
- Electrical Requirement: Single Phase 220 V AC
Benefits and Uses of the Dart Impact Tester in the packaging industry
In the plastic film industry, plastic films will serve to be the protective barrier between external and internal contaminants. But what if, these films will get a break? It will cause product damage. Thus, it is important for you to test these films against freely falling darts. Therefore, with the use of the Presto dart impact tester, we will be able to determine the quality of these films and make sure that the right materials will be delivered to the customers with ease.
